New recruits expand forage specialist team26 February 2019

Forage crop specialist Field Options has expanded its team with the appointment of two new area managers, Rhys Owen and Nick Duggan.

Rhys has taken on a business support and development role covering north Shropshire, Cheshire and north Wales. A Harper Adams University graduate, and BASIS and FACTS qualified, he has ten years’ experience in grassland management and a wide range of forage and arable crops. Rhys will combine his role at Field Options with that of an agronomist with sister company County Crops. Based in north Wales, he maintains an interest in his family’s sheep and dairy farm.

Nick joins Field Options in a business support and development role, covering south Shropshire, Herefordshire, Worcestershire, Gloucestershire, Monmouthshire and east Powys. Also a graduate of Harper Adams University, he has gained a wealth of relevant experience over the previous five years in technical sales and customer support in the seed trade. Nick remains involved in his family’s sheep, beef and arable farm near Leominster and will operate from Field Options’ Presteigne office.

Commenting on the appointments, Field Options director Francis Dunne said that he expects both new recruits to bring a wealth of valuable knowledge and practical experience to the company.

“We’ve taken the opportunity to restructure and add two individuals with real expertise in forage crops and a thorough understanding of their role across livestock and arable businesses. The need for quality forage is growing, right across the farming industry, as farms seek greater production efficiency and sustainability, so we are very excited about what these two enthusiasts can bring to Field Options.”

Field Options, part of the ProCam group of companies, supplies a full range of forage crops, ensiling products and specialist fertilisers alongside forage planning and soil management advice.
